INDIANAPOLIS—The most pressing health and safety topics in the non-tire elastomer market will be the focus when the 2021 Environmental Health and Safety Summit takes place virtually May 26-27.
The gathering is hosted by the Association for Rubber Products Manufacturers and features talks from experts and manufacturing executives on best leadership and safety practices.
In turn, other executives and industry experts can network and attend sessions on industrial hygiene, combustible dust, risk homeostasis and the enhancement of a company's safety culture.
"As the lead organization for rubber product manufacturers, ARPM truly understands the environmental, health and safety needs of our industry and has taken aggressive steps to help its members and other rubber professionals tackle and resolve these issues," said Letha Keslar, ARPM managing director. "Environmental, health and safety issues are vitally important to our industry and being able to purely focus on these topics in such a dynamic environment is truly priceless."
